Austro-Hungary, navy officer's sabre M.1850/71

Starting price 400 EUR
Result:
1.100 EUR

73 cm long stick-back blade, in the 3rd quarter etched cartouche with anchor beneath crown / double-headed eagle on both sides, nickel-plated, marked "Ludwig Zeitler Vienna VIII [.... ]", slight pitting at the basket, asymmetrical pierced brass basket with double eagle and nautical depictions, grip with fish-skin and twisted brass wire winding, black leather covered wooden scabbard with raised brass fittings, red shock felt, sabre link and gold officer's sword knot ("FJI"). Condition II-III.
